What to Do After an Accident in Phoenix

The steps you take immediately after an accident have a significant impact on your claim. Call 911 and get a police report filed β€” this is critical evidence. Seek medical attention even if you feel fine β€” some injuries take days to present symptoms and gaps in treatment are used by insurers to deny claims. Document everything β€” photograph the scene, vehicles, injuries, and any hazards. Do not give recorded statements to insurance adjusters without legal representation. Contact a Phoenix accident lawyer as soon as possible.

How Long Do I Have to File an Accident Claim in Arizona?

Arizona's statute of limitations gives you two years from the date of your accident to file a personal injury claim. Missing this deadline permanently eliminates your right to compensation regardless of how strong your case is. Beyond the deadline, evidence degrades β€” camera footage is overwritten, witnesses become harder to locate, and physical evidence disappears. The sooner you get a lawyer reviewing your case, the stronger your position.

What if I was partly at fault for the accident?

Arizona uses pure comparative fault β€” you can still recover compensation even if you were partially responsible. Your damages are reduced by your percentage of fault but you are not barred from claiming.

How long does an accident claim take in Phoenix?

Most accident claims settle within 3-18 months depending on injury severity and insurer cooperation. Cases that go to trial take longer. An attorney can give you a realistic timeline based on your specific circumstances.
